Column width redistribution was incorrect if:
Something like this would trigger it:
<td style="width:1%"> <- small percentage size
<div style=width:500px> <- large min width
Its a bit more complicated than that because of reverse percentage
width computation, you have to hit just the right ration of min/%.
The correct fix matches FF/Legacy:
